The idea of dental implants has historical roots that might be traced back 1000's of years. Historical proof means that early makes an attempt at dental prosthetics emerged in various cultures worldwide. Archaeological findings reveal that ancient civilizations, such as the Egyptians and the Etruscans, experimented with rudimentary forms of dental implants.
Ancient Egyptians are identified to have created prosthetic units made from wood or ivory. They generally used metal posts to support these devices, indicating that the understanding of integrating materials into the human physique was not totally overseas to them. This reflects a cultural reliance on restorative techniques in dentistry long before trendy developments happened.

The Etruscans, an ancient civilization in Italy, confirmed outstanding ingenuity by crafting dental bridges and partial dentures from animal enamel, ivory, and even gold. Remnants of these devices have been present in Etruscan tombs, showcasing their subtle craftsmanship and understanding of oral health. Such practices reveal a deep-rooted consciousness of aesthetics and performance long earlier than up to date dental science emerged.
The Greeks and Romans additional advanced the realm of dental care. They documented various therapy strategies for dental points, including tooth loss, of their medical texts. Notably, the writings of Hippocrates and Galen allude to using dental implants. Treatments usually involved the usage of metals, corresponding to silver, to switch lost tooth, though these early implants provided restricted success.
However, it wasn’t until the 19th century that extra structured advances in dental implants had been seen. In 1809, the first documented dental implant procedure took place in France. A dentist named Pierre Fauchard, thought of the father of modern dentistry, laid foundational theories concerning tooth replacement. His observations on the significance of preserving oral health laid the groundwork for future improvements.
In the latter half of the nineteenth century, researchers started experimenting with materials like gold and platinum for dental implants. These metals were extra sturdy than the materials used in earlier makes an attempt, marking a big shift in the approach to dental restoration. While these early metals didn't absolutely integrate with bone, they represented a step towards creating more practical and reliable implants.

The 20th century saw groundbreaking developments in materials science, paving the way for the modern era of dental implants - Dental Implant Aftercare Instructions in Zeeland MI. In the Nineteen Fifties, Swedish orthopedic surgeon Per-Ingvar Brånemark found the concept of osseointegration, a course of whereby bone bonds on to the surface of a dental implant. His experiments with titanium, noted for its biocompatibility, completely reworked the sector of dental restoration
Brånemark's analysis led to clinical trials within the Nineteen Sixties, during which titanium implants have been successfully built-in into the jawbone of sufferers. This marked a pivotal moment in dental history, as it bridged the hole between surgical principle and practical software. The use of titanium turned the gold commonplace for dental implants, because it minimized the chance of rejection by the human physique.

In the following a long time, the technology and techniques surrounding dental implants developed considerably. Innovations in implant design improved stability and longevity, catering to numerous dental needs. The introduction of different shapes and floor treatments additional enhanced the success rates of implants, selling more options for dentists and sufferers alike.
As consciousness and acceptance of dental implants grew, so did the number of procedures carried out annually. Their growth paralleled advances in surgical techniques, imaging technology, and post-operative care, ensuring better outcomes for sufferers. Dental professionals began to emphasise the importance of affected person education and pre-surgical assessments, making a extra comprehensive strategy to implant dentistry.
The late twentieth century and early 21st century ushered in an era of minimally invasive methods, decreasing recovery time and improving overall patient experiences. Computer-guided surgery and 3D imaging applied sciences remodeled the planning and execution of dental implant procedures. This progressive shift provided unprecedented precision, permitting for customized treatment plans tailored specifically to particular person needs.

What are dental implants, and when had been they first used?
Dental implants are artificial tooth roots positioned in the jaw to support alternative tooth or bridges. The concept of dental implants dates back hundreds of years, with the earliest identified implants found in historic civilizations around 2000 BCE, significantly in historic Egypt and the Mayan tradition.
How has the technology behind dental implants advanced over time?
The technology has considerably evolved from early makes an attempt, such as wood or ivory implants, to fashionable titanium implants. Titanium's biocompatibility and ability to fuse with bone, generally identified as osseointegration, had been established within the Sixties by Dr. Per-Ingvar Brånemark, revolutionizing the sector.

Who was a pioneer in dental implant development?
Dr. Per-Ingvar Brånemark is commonly considered a pioneer in dental implantology. His research laid the groundwork for the trendy dental implant procedures, particularly the concept of osseointegration, which basically modified the way dental restorations are approached.
What materials have been traditionally used for dental implants?

Historically, materials such as gold, porcelain, and even human bones were used for dental implants. These earlier makes an attempt typically faced rejection by the body, unlike fashionable titanium and zirconia, which are actually favored for his or her durability and biocompatibility.
When did dental implants become widely accepted in dentistry?
Dental implants started gaining broad acceptance in the Nineteen Eighties and Nineteen Nineties, primarily as a outcome of developments in surgical strategies and materials. Clinical success charges increased, leading to improved public and professional confidence in implant procedures.

What are the success charges of dental implants based on historical data?
Historically, dental implants have shown various success rates, with early models having decrease success. However, trendy implants boast success charges of over 95% for sure cases, influenced by factors similar to bone quality and oral hygiene practices.
How do historical practices affect right now's implant techniques?
Historical practices laid the foundation for right now's techniques. Learning from early failures led to improved materials, surgical methods, and affected person care protocols, making modern procedures safer and more predictable than prior to now.

Were dental implants used in ancient civilizations?
Yes, archaeological findings point out that historic civilizations, together with the Egyptians and Mayans, utilized rudimentary forms of dental implants (Impact Of Dental Implants On Speech in Olive Center MI). These included shells or stones positioned within the jaw, showcasing an early understanding of tooth alternative
What is the importance of osseointegration in dental implants?
Osseointegration is the process by which dental implants turn out to be securely anchored within the jawbone. This phenomenon, found in the Nineteen Sixties, is a cornerstone in implant dentistry, because it ensures the steadiness and longevity of the implant, permitting for a practical and aesthetic restoration.
